"Now unto Him that is able to do exceeding abundantly above all that we ask or think, according to the power that works in us." Ephesians 3:20
To be found in Jesus, Paul says, is worth more than all of his religion, race, and ritual. It is a relationship with the Almighty God. It is Jesus. Paul says, "I'm tired of trying. I'm going to start trusting." Basically Paul lived a life of working his way to heaven before he met the Lord on the road to Damascus (see Acts 9). Legalism is a terrible thing. It is a harsh task master under which no one can succeed.
Liberty, not legalism, is what the Lord Jesus Christ offers... freedom... not bondage; relationship... not religion. We give up nothing for which Jesus will not abundantly offer more than we could ever hope or dream.
Read Colossians 3:11. What does it mean for Christ to be your "all in all"?
